When fully awake, I have aphantasia: I cannot experience my mental imagery, even though I know it is there and I can use it for drawing and design. When I begin to fall asleep, it often becomes visible, but not from the front (the direction of attention)—it slides in "sideways".
I trained myself when I was young but I stopped. Sometimes I have spontaneous lucid dreams but it is rare. I have greater control of the hypnagogic state while waking up, but need to be in a totally quiet place.
